Research on Breakthrough of Core Technology of New Energy Automobile Industry Based on Evolutionary Game
In view of the lack of high-end and highperformance products in China's new energy automobile industry, the evolutionary game model of the core technology breakthrough of the new energy automobile industry is constructed, the behavioral strategies of multi-agent participation are analyzed, and the conditions of the system's progressive stability are discussed to realize the system's Tired balance. The research results show that the key to realizing the breakthrough of core technology in new energy automobile enterprises lies in the degree of government incentives, the additional cost of enterprise investment, the current opportunity loss of enterprises, and the innovation cost invested by academic institutions. Keywords—new energy vehicles; core technology breakthrough; evolutionary game; interest balance
